About the Role
Responsible for administering, supporting, and optimizing the AlgoSec Security Management Suite to automate firewall policy management, strengthen security governance, improve compliance reporting, and provide visibility into application connectivity and traffic flows across the enterprise network.
Responsibilities
- Administer and support the AlgoSec Security Management Suite, including:
- Firewall Analyzer
- FireFlow
- ObjectFlow
- AppViz
- Manage and optimize firewall policies using AlgoSec automation capabilities.
- Perform risk analysis and identify security policy violations.
- Support firewall access recertification and compliance initiatives.
- Govern firewall change management workflows through FireFlow.
- Generate security and compliance reports for audit and regulatory requirements.
- Analyze network traffic flows and application connectivity dependencies using AppViz.
- Review and optimize security policies to improve network security posture.
- Collaborate with network, security, and application teams to implement secure connectivity requirements.
- Ensure firewall rules align with security standards and business requirements.

Required Skills
- Strong hands-on experience with the AlgoSec Security Management Suite:
- Firewall Analyzer
- FireFlow
- ObjectFlow
- AppViz
- Firewall policy management and optimization.
- Security policy analysis and risk assessment.
- Firewall change governance and workflow management.
- Access recertification and compliance reporting.
- Application connectivity mapping and dependency analysis.
- Network traffic flow analysis.
- Security policy automation and orchestration.
- Enterprise network security concepts and firewall technologies.
